What Are Cloves?

Cloves are the dried flower buds of the Syzygium aromaticum tree, native to the Spice Islands near Indonesia. Known for their unique flavor profile—warm, sweet, and slightly bitter—they have been used in culinary dishes and traditional medicine for centuries.

Nutritional Profile of Cloves

Despite their small size, cloves pack a punch in terms of nutrition. A teaspoon of ground cloves contains:

  • Calories: 6
  • Carbohydrates: 1.4 g
  • Fiber: 1 g
  • Vitamins and Minerals: Cloves are rich in manganese, vitamin K, calcium, and magnesium, making them a valuable addition to any diet.

These nutrients not only contribute to their flavor but also to their health benefits.

How to Incorporate Cloves into Your Diet for Weight Loss

Now that we understand the benefits of cloves, let’s explore practical ways to incorporate them into our daily routine. The versatility of cloves allows for various methods of consumption, making it easy to include them in your diet.

1. Clove Water

One of the simplest ways to enjoy the benefits of cloves is to drink clove-infused water. Here’s how to make it:

  • Ingredients: 4-5 whole cloves, 1 cup of water.
  • Instructions:
    • Soak the cloves in water overnight.
    • Strain the water in the morning and drink it on an empty stomach.
    • Alternatively, you can boil the cloves for a few minutes to enhance infusion.

2. Clove Tea

Clove tea is another delightful way to enjoy the benefits of cloves. To prepare clove tea:

  • Ingredients: 2-3 whole cloves, 1 cup of hot water, honey (optional).
  • Instructions:
    • Steep the cloves in hot water for about 10 minutes.
    • Strain and add honey to taste.
    • Enjoy this warm beverage in the morning or after meals to aid digestion.

3. Cloves in Smoothies

Adding ground cloves to your smoothies can enhance flavor and increase health benefits. Here’s a quick recipe:

  • Ingredients: 1 banana, 1 cup of spinach, 1 tablespoon of ground cloves, 1 cup of almond milk.
  • Instructions:
    • Blend all ingredients until smooth.
    • Enjoy as a nutritious breakfast or snack.

4. Clove-Infused Honey

Clove-infused honey is a sweet way to incorporate cloves into your diet:

  • Ingredients: 1 cup of honey, 5-6 whole cloves.
  • Instructions:
    • Place the honey and cloves in a jar.
    • Let it sit for a week to allow the flavors to blend.
    • Use it in teas, on toast, or as a sweetener in recipes.

5. Chewing Whole Cloves

For those who prefer a direct approach, chewing on whole cloves can provide immediate benefits. However, be mindful of the strong flavor and limit yourself to a few at a time.

6. Clove Oil Massage

While not for ingestion, clove oil can be massaged into the skin to potentially help with inflammation and circulation. Always dilute it with a carrier oil and do a patch test before use.

7. Cloves in Cooking

Cloves can be added to various dishes, such as stews, curries, and baked goods, to enhance flavor while reaping their health benefits.
